WHAT IS MONARCH MONEY?

Monarch Money, which is an all-in-one money platform according to their website, is a comprehensive financial app designed to simplify money management and empower users to achieve their financial goals. Developed with user experience in mind, Monarch Money offers a wide range of features aimed at helping individuals track their spending, budget effectively, invest wisely, and save effortlessly.

One of the standout features of Monarch Money is its intuitive interface, which allows users to easily navigate through various sections of the app and access essential financial information at a glance. Whether you’re a seasoned investor or just starting your financial journey, Monarch Money provides the tools and resources you need to make informed decisions and take control of your finances.

WHAT ARE THE PROS AND CONS OF MONARCH MONEY?

Pros:

  1. User-friendly Interface: Monarch Money’s intuitive interface makes it easy for users to navigate and access essential financial information.
  2. Comprehensive Features: From budgeting and saving to investing and retirement planning, Monarch Money offers a wide range of features to help users achieve their financial goals.
  3. Personalized Recommendations: Monarch Money provides personalized recommendations based on users’ financial goals, risk tolerance, and investment preferences, making it easier to make informed decisions.

Cons:

  1. Limited Account Integration: While Monarch Money supports integration with many financial institutions, some users may find that their bank or investment accounts are not supported.
  2. Subscription Fees: Monarch Money offers a subscription-based model (pricing), which may not be suitable for users who prefer free financial apps.
